    My bike threw up today

    Mine did that last year. Turned out to be a bolt had come loose and dropped down to block the fan from turning. I got caught in traffic and it smoked a little - got home and it made a mess. Topped up the coolant (not realizing the fan problem), next day I hit heavier traffic and ended up with...
